Abstract
一种具定位功能的枢纽器,其包含有:一基座、一第一支架、一垂直轴、一第二支架及一垂直定位组件;该第一支架是透过垂直轴以可水平转动方式设置在基座上,该第二支架是透过二水平轴以可转动方式设置在基座上,该垂直定位组件是设置在第二支架与基座之间,并可令第二支架在相对第一支架几个特定角度时定位于基座上。
A hinge device with a positioning function comprises: a base, a first bracket, a vertical axis, a second bracket and a vertical positioning component; the first bracket is arranged on the base in a horizontally rotatable manner through the vertical axis, the second bracket is arranged on the base in a rotatable manner through two horizontal axes, and the vertical positioning component is arranged between the second bracket and the base, and can position the second bracket on the base at several specific angles relative to the first bracket.

背景技术 Background technique
目前流行的掀盖式行动电话均在基座与上盖之间设置有一枢纽器,以便令上盖与基座可相折迭或展开,目前应用于行动电话的枢纽器是具有一第一支架及一第二支架,第一支架是与基座连接,第二支架是与上盖连接,两支架透过二枢轴连接,借此令第二支架可相对第一支架作水平及垂直枢转。Currently popular clamshell mobile phones are provided with a hinge between the base and the top cover so that the top cover and the base can be folded or unfolded. The hinges currently used in mobile phones have a first bracket and a second bracket, the first bracket is connected to the base, the second bracket is connected to the upper cover, and the two brackets are connected through two pivots, so that the second bracket can pivot horizontally and vertically relative to the first bracket .
此外,在第一支架与第二支架之间设置有定位结构,以令上盖可相对基座定位于某个特定角度。然而,定位结构呈裸露状态的各组件之间可能会堆积灰尘,导致定位结构效果打折扣。In addition, a positioning structure is provided between the first bracket and the second bracket, so that the upper cover can be positioned at a specific angle relative to the base. However, dust may accumulate between components in which the positioning structure is exposed, resulting in a reduced effect of the positioning structure.
发明内容 Contents of the invention
本实用新型创作人根据现有枢纽器定位结构组件之间堆积灰尘的问题,改良其不足与缺失,进而实用新型出一种具定位功能的枢纽器。According to the problem of dust accumulation between the positioning structure components of the existing hinge device, the creator of the utility model improved its shortcomings and defects, and then developed a hinge device with a positioning function in the utility model.
本实用新型主要目的是提供一种具定位功能的枢纽器,该枢纽器的定位结构的外包覆有一套筒以便避免定位结构组件之间堆积灰尘。The main purpose of the utility model is to provide a hinge with a positioning function. The positioning structure of the hinge is covered with a sleeve so as to prevent dust from accumulating between the components of the positioning structure.
为达上述目的,是令前述枢纽器包含有:For reaching above-mentioned purpose, be to make aforementioned hub include:
一基座,其二侧分别垂直突伸有一定位板及一固定板,该定位板外侧形成有二内定位槽,该固定板上向外突伸形成有一枢轴;A base, a positioning plate and a fixing plate protruding vertically from its two sides, two inner positioning grooves are formed on the outside of the positioning plate, and a pivot is formed on the fixing plate protruding outward;
一第一支架,是以可水平转动方式设置在基座上;A first bracket is arranged on the base in a horizontally rotatable manner;
一垂直轴,是以可水平转动方式贯穿设置在基座上,且底端与第一支架相固设,令第一支架可相对基座水平转动;A vertical shaft is installed on the base in a horizontally rotatable manner, and the bottom end is fixed to the first bracket so that the first bracket can rotate horizontally relative to the base;
一第二支架,是以可垂直转动方式设置在基座上,是由一第一连结板、一第一水平轴及一第二连结板所构成,该第一连结板是以可垂直转动方式设置在基座定位板上,该第一水平轴是以可转动方式穿设该定位板且其外侧端与第一连结板相固设,该第二连结板是以可转动方式设置在基座固定板的枢轴上,且具有一轴孔以供该枢轴所穿过;及A second bracket is arranged on the base in a vertically rotatable manner, and is composed of a first connecting plate, a first horizontal shaft and a second connecting plate, and the first connecting plate is vertically rotatable Set on the positioning plate of the base, the first horizontal shaft is rotatably passed through the positioning plate and its outer end is fixed with the first connecting plate, and the second connecting plate is rotatably arranged on the base on the pivot of the fixed plate and has a shaft hole for the pivot to pass through; and
一垂直定位组件,是设置在基座定位板与第二支架的第一连结板之间,且包含有一套筒、一内定位环、一外定位环、一弹簧及一外定位塞,该套筒是中空,穿套在第一水平轴上,套筒内侧端是一体成型于定位板上,该内定位环是以可滑动而不可转动方式穿套在第一水平轴上并紧邻定位板,且其上形成有二与内定位槽相对应的内定位块,该外定位环是以可滑动而不可转动方式穿套在第一水平轴上,且其上形成有二外定位块,该弹簧是穿套在第一水平轴上,且位于内定位环与外定位环之间,该外定位塞是以可转动方式穿套在第一水平轴上,与套筒外侧端相固设而与外定位环相邻,且其上形成有二与外定位块相对应的外定位槽。A vertical positioning component is arranged between the base positioning plate and the first connecting plate of the second bracket, and includes a sleeve, an inner positioning ring, an outer positioning ring, a spring and an outer positioning plug. The barrel is hollow and fitted on the first horizontal shaft. The inner end of the sleeve is integrally formed on the positioning plate. The inner positioning ring is slidable and non-rotatable and fitted on the first horizontal shaft and is adjacent to the positioning plate. And there are two inner positioning blocks corresponding to the inner positioning grooves formed on it, the outer positioning ring is slidable and non-rotatable on the first horizontal shaft, and two outer positioning blocks are formed on it, the spring It is fitted on the first horizontal shaft and is located between the inner positioning ring and the outer positioning ring. The outer positioning plug is rotatably fitted on the first horizontal shaft, fixed with the outer end of the sleeve and connected with the outer end of the sleeve. The outer positioning ring is adjacent, and two outer positioning grooves corresponding to the outer positioning blocks are formed on it.
利用上述技术手段,第一支架与第二支架可分别设置在一掀盖式装置的本体与上盖上,垂直定位组件是供第二支架相对第一支架定位在两者夹角为0度或180时,借此避免上盖相对本体任意转动,此外套筒将垂直定位组件的各定位环与弹簧包覆于内,避免因灰尘堆积而导致垂直定位组件失效,借此可增进枢纽器寿命。Utilizing the above-mentioned technical means, the first bracket and the second bracket can be arranged on the body and the upper cover of a clamshell device respectively, and the vertical positioning component is for the second bracket to be positioned relative to the first bracket at an angle between them of 0 degree or 180 to prevent the upper cover from rotating arbitrarily relative to the main body. The outer sleeve covers the positioning rings and springs of the vertical positioning assembly to prevent the vertical positioning assembly from failing due to dust accumulation, thereby increasing the life of the hinge.
前述基座底部形成有二定位槽,一水平定位与限位组件是设置在基座与垂直轴上,且包含有一定位环、一限位突块及一限位环,该定位环是以可滑动而不可转动方式穿套在垂直轴上,且其上突伸形成有二与基座定位槽相对应的定位块,该限位环是自垂直轴顶端径向向外突伸,且其上形成有一半环状的限位块,该限位突块是一体成型在基座顶部,该限位环是形成在垂直轴顶端径向向外突伸,且其上形成有一与限位突块相对应的半环状限位块。Two positioning grooves are formed on the bottom of the aforementioned base. A horizontal positioning and limiting component is arranged on the base and the vertical shaft, and includes a positioning ring, a limiting protrusion and a limiting ring. The positioning ring can be used to The vertical shaft is slipped and non-rotatable, and there are two positioning blocks corresponding to the positioning grooves of the base protruding from it. The limiting ring protrudes radially outward from the top of the vertical shaft, and the upper A semi-circular stopper is formed, the stopper is integrally formed on the top of the base, the stopper ring is formed on the top of the vertical shaft and protrudes radially outward, and a stopper is formed on it Corresponding semi-circular limit block.
前述基座定位板内侧壁上形成有一限位凸点,该第一水平轴的挡板周缘上形成有一半环状限位块,该半环状限位块两端可分别与该限位凸点相抵靠以便限制第一水平轴不得进一步转动。A limiting protrusion is formed on the inner wall of the aforementioned base positioning plate, and a semi-circular limiting block is formed on the periphery of the baffle plate of the first horizontal axis. points abut against further rotation of the first horizontal axis.
前述套筒外侧端上形成有复数外固定槽,该外定位塞外缘上形成有复数分别与该等外固定槽相固设的外固定块。A plurality of outer fixing grooves are formed on the outer end of the aforementioned sleeve, and a plurality of outer fixing blocks respectively fixed to the outer fixing grooves are formed on the outer edge of the outer positioning plug.
